Common Cladding Replacement Jobs
Cladding Replacement - involves removing and replacing damaged or outdated exterior cladding for improved home protection.
Vinyl Cladding Replacement - upgrades worn or faded vinyl siding to enhance curb appeal and durability.
Fiber Cement Cladding Replacement - replaces cracked or rotting fiber cement panels for long-lasting weather resistance.
Wood Cladding Replacement - restores or updates wooden siding to maintain aesthetic appeal and structural integrity.
Metal Cladding Replacement - updates corroded or outdated metal panels to ensure continued exterior protection.
Insulated Cladding Replacement - improves energy efficiency by installing new insulated exterior panels.
Cladding Replacement Questions
What is cladding replacement? Cladding replacement involves removing outdated or damaged exterior panels and installing new materials to improve appearance and protection.
Why consider cladding replacement? It enhances the property's curb appeal, increases weather resistance, and helps prevent structural issues caused by aging or damage.
What types of cladding materials are available? Common options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al, each offering different aesthetic and durability benefits.
When is cladding replacement necessary? Replacement is recommended when existing cladding shows signs of significant damage, warping, or persistent deterioration that cannot be repaired effectively.
